What is Online Reputation?

Online reputation refers to how a brand identifies itself online and how the general public perceives it online. It’s the consensus public opinion about an individual or an organization based on their online presence. The general online reputation is directly dependent upon the behavior of that organization and is based on the subjective thoughts of all observers and customers. 

Online Reputation Important

An online business with a good overall reputation is more likely to attract new customers as compared to a business that pays little to no attention to its brand image. People often think of reputation and branding as two entirely similar things, but they aren’t similar. Yes, they are the two sides of the same coin but there are some differences as well. Branding can be achieved through effective paid marketing but reputation takes years of consistent effort. Constant branding and maintaining a brand’s image for a long time leads to a good reputation.

Securing all your login details and keeping an eye on who has access to your websites and social media platforms is essential to protect reputation of your business. This helps prevent a data breach thus preventing unauthorized access to your company’s personal data.  

Ask all your employees who represent your organization to google themselves and remove any controversial information that appears on the first page of Google. Any controversial political or religious opinion that could scare off potential customers or investors should be removed as it can negatively impact the company’s reputation.

Remember that the first step to branding is to register your brand logo and name online. Brand mention tools or google alerts about the mention of your brand will only work effectively if you have already done this. Doing this also eliminates the probability of some fake business with a similar name or domain affecting your business’s online reputation. 

Creating google alerts to keep track of online brand mentions can save you from the hassle of looking at Yelp, Twitter, Facebook, Google reviews, Angie’s List, local news sites, Next Door, and blogs all by yourself. By far the most credible source of online reputation, Google reviews, Yelp reviews, Facebook reviews, and other social media platform reviews can either make or break a company’s online reputation. Getting more and more reviews is essential to boosting your business’s online reputation.

Review sites are often a place for your brand’s most frustrated customers to vent. Most of the time only the people with a bad experience take the time to post negative feedback as a revenge tactic. 

According to a recent study, a consumer is 21% more likely to leave a review after a bad experience. Online reputation management tools like Trust Analytica help encourage every customer either with a positive or negative experience to give feedback about their experience. This way the overall review rating of the business increases, contributing to the business’s success. 

It is your job to identify active conversations about your business and respond to the negative ones ASAP. You are responsible to find and root out those vocal customers who are so upset about your business that they want to tell the whole world about their experience. 

As soon as you find someone posting negative comments about your business ask them or try to discover what went wrong. Be willing to correct your mistake and do everything in your power to fix the issues being faced by the customer. Doing this would most probably turn a 1-star review into a 5-star review in no time.

Set proper guidelines for staff members and social media managers on what you expect from them, what they can or can’t say, and how they are supposed to respond. Also, give regular reminders to them about company policies. 

Dont solely rely on social media managers to keep track of everything happening on social media as it can be a hectic task. Encourage everyone (employees, stakeholders, suppliers, customers) to report anything they see online that is affecting the company’s reputation.

Here are some expert suggestions for different types of monitoring:

All reputational risks do not come from just your customers or end-users. Many risks could also arise from outside your organization, mostly unethical partners, suppliers, agents, and contractors. Being mindful of these risks can save your business from the shame of being trialed publicly on some web forum or a social media platform.

If you get it wrong once then dont get it wrong twice. Always learn what went wrong and list loopholes that allowed the breaches. Take note of your mistake and take measures to never let them happen again. 

Always have transparent workplace practices that are written in detail in the contract and signed by all employees before they join your company. See if there is any discrimination in your organization against a specific race, caste, or color. 

Also, monitor if your social media managers are biased against people of some specific country or people with different political or religious views. Quickly respond to these problems before they start to snowball.

Plan in advance how you are going to respond to negative comments, complaints, and reputation bombs. Avoid knee-jerk reactions or deciding after seeing a negative review pop out.

Know when to involve the authorities and dont try to be nice to people who break the law. Report online threats and hate speech cases to concerned authorities. Remember that it’s not always the seller’s fault and know when to take a stand for your employees.

Posting feedback about false information on your social media posts or stories can also stop false information from spreading any further.
